Hi Chandler,

Fixing include paths is not enough - you should also fix library
lookup paths for dynamic linker in Clang driver. Currently if the
build tree has both Clang binary and built libc++ like this:
<...>/bin/clang++
<...>/lib/libc++.so

Clang binary is not able to locate libc++.so with -stdlib=libc++
provided. Therefore the following brute-force bootstrap process
wouldn't work:
(1) configure a new build tree with default options and build Clang and libc++
(2) configure a new build tree with just-built Clang as c/c++ compiler
and specify LLVM_ENABLE_LIBCXX=ON

I'll try to take a closer look at this (and potentially fix the
driver) tomorrow, unless someone who has more understanding picks it
up from here.

> Log:
> Make the Linux support for finding libc++ somewhat less braindead.
> 
> Now instead of just looking in the system root for it, we also look
> relative to the clang binary's directory. This should "just work" in
> almost all cases. I've added test cases accordingly.
> 
> This is probably *very* worthwhile to backport to the 3.4 branch so that
> folks can check it out, build it, and use that as their host compiler
> going forward.

> // Check if libc++ has been enabled and provide its include paths if so.
> if (GetCXXStdlibType(DriverArgs) == ToolChain::CST_Libcxx) {
> -    // libc++ is always installed at a fixed path on Linux currently.
> -    addSystemInclude(DriverArgs, CC1Args,
> -                     getDriver().SysRoot + "/usr/include/c++/v1");
> +    const std::string LibCXXIncludePathCandidates[] = {
> +      // The primary location is within the Clang installation.
> +      // FIXME: We shouldn't hard code 'v1' here to make Clang future proof to
> +      // newer ABI versions.
> +      getDriver().Dir + "/../include/c++/v1",
> +
> +      // We also check the system as for a long time this is the only place Clang \
> looked. +      // FIXME: We should really remove this. It doesn't make any sense.
> +      getDriver().SysRoot + "/usr/include/c++/v1"
> +    };
> +    for (unsigned i = 0; i < llvm::array_lengthof(LibCXXIncludePathCandidates);
> +         ++i) {
> +      if (!llvm::sys::fs::exists(LibCXXIncludePathCandidates[i]))
> +        continue;
> +      // Add the first candidate that exists.
> +      addSystemInclude(DriverArgs, CC1Args, LibCXXIncludePathCandidates[i]);
> +      break;
> +    }
> return;
> }
